About This School

Carlisle High School is a public high in Carlisle, Ohio, serving 415 students in grades 9-12. The school maintains a 12:1 student-teacher ratio with 34 teachers on staff, while the average teacher salary is $91,375. Guidance services are provided through a ratio of one counselor for every 415 students. Students at the school represent a diverse demographic, with 52% female and 48% male enrollment. The student body is 93% White, 3% Hispanic, 2% Two or More Races, and 1% Black.
